The shower began with a flower-arranging session, followed by a dessert-tasting experience overseen by The Mark hotel’s head chef. Meghan’s makeup artist friend Daniel Martin, who did her makeup for her royal wedding, posted an adorable photo of some of the on-theme cookies at the baby shower.
“Such an incredible day celebrating #babylove,” he penned.
The florist who arranged the flowers also shared a behind-the-scenes glimpse from inside the shower – notice the beautiful orange tree in the background?
Guest Gayle King, who is the best friend of Oprah, said the flower arrangements made by guests at the shower were later donated to charity.
“We all each made an individual vase,” Gayle said on US breakfast show CBS This Morning. “Then Meghan, at her request, got in touch with an organisation I’ve never heard of with, called Repeat Roses, and they were all donated to different charities.
“I thought that was a very sweet thing… It just speaks to who she is. She’s kind, she’s very generous. And a really, really sweet person.”
The charity Repeat Roses has shared photos from inside the shower as their florist prepared for the event at the Mark Hotel before sharing a slew of shots of children from a local cancer charity with the bouquets made by Meghan and her guests.
Repeat Roses shared these precious snapshots of cancer patients at Ronald McDonald house with bouquets of Meghan’s flowers.

Baby showers are typically something that the royal family avoids. However, it is a big tradition in Meghan’s native US.
Royal expert Victoria Arbiter previously told The Sun that since royals are “very wealthy, a lavish baby shower would be seen as highly inappropriate. There’s nothing they can’t go out and buy themselves”.
